Horizontal driven roller conveyor
Sláma, Jakub ; Malášek, Jiří (referee) ; Kašpárek, Jaroslav (advisor)
This thesis deals with design-driven horizontal roller tracks for the transport of steel castings in the interoperation internal transport, was made functional calculation of the roller track and determined the main dimensions of lines, the work deals with designing the drive, strength calculation poháněcího chain and check the frame lines. Subsequently, the preparation of its finished drawing lines, assembly lines and drawing section drawing of the drive subassembly lines.

Horizontal driven roller conveyor
Viktora, Luboš ; Malášek, Jiří (referee) ; Kašpárek, Jaroslav (advisor)
The bachelor thesis deals with the horizontal driven roller conveyor. The thesis includes the calculation of the roller track including active resistance, the choice of engine, transmission design, roller design and its control, frame design and its control. Based on calculations, 3D model designed in a CAD system Autodesk Inventor and drawings are developed.

Long-distance belt conveyance
Monsport, Jan ; Kašpárek, Jaroslav (referee) ; Zeizinger, Lukáš (advisor)
This bachelor thesis deals with the draft of long-distance conveyor transportation of dolomite that is crushed according to specified parameters. In the first chapters, there is a description of the conveyor transportation and its classification. In continuation, the individual parts of the long-distance conveyor belt as well as the characteristics of the transported material are described. In addition, this thesis deals with the calculations according to the ČSN ISO 5048 standard. The selection of individual components of the conveyor belt transportation is captured here as well.

Horizontal driven roller conveyor
Hájek, Lukáš ; Jonák, Martin (referee) ; Kašpárek, Jaroslav (advisor)
This bachelor thesis deals with the design-driven horizontal roller conveyor 15 m long which is used for the transport of cardboard boxes with metal material in a storeroom. A total weight of this box is 35 kg. The conveyor is functionally calculated and its main dimensions are determined. There is designed draft power, strength calculations chain, frame and strut trails. The set of drawing line, drawing section, drawing drive and manufacturing drawing sidewall are treated as a drawing documentation.
